Accuracy of ChatGPT in head and neck oncological board decisions: preliminary findings.

ABSTRACT
OBJECTIVES:
To evaluate the ChatGPT-4 performance in oncological board decisions.METHODS:
Twenty medical records of patients with head and neck cancer were evaluated by ChatGPT-4 for additional examinations, management, and therapeutic approaches. The ChatGPT-4 propositions were assessed with the Artificial Intelligence Performance Instrument. The stability of ChatGPT-4 was evaluated through regenerated answers at 1-day interval.RESULTS:
ChatGPT-4 provided adequate explanations for cTNM staging in 19 cases (95%). ChatGPT-4 proposed a significant higher number of additional examinations than practitioners (72 versus 103; p = 0.001). ChatGPT-4 indications of endoscopy-biopsy, HPV research, ultrasonography, and PET-CT were consistent with the oncological board decisions. The therapeutic propositions of ChatGPT-4 were accurate in 13 cases (65%). Most additional examination and primary treatment propositions were consistent throughout regenerated response process.CONCLUSIONS:
ChatGPT-4 may be an adjunctive theoretical tool in oncological board simple decisions.Palabras clave
